JAMB Fixes Date For Supplementary Exam

  The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board (JAMB) has fixed Saturday, September 24, 2022, for conduction of a supplementary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ME) for 67 candidates. JAMB Remits N3.51bn As 2021 Operating Surplus

  The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board (JAMB) has remitted a staggering N3.51 billiion to the federal government as 2021 operating surplus This was revealed in a statement by Dr Fabian Benjamin, the spokesperson in Abuja on Wednesday.
